    • The journey of Arabic numerals from India to the Western world is a significant story. In the 8th century, Indian scholars introduced these numerals to the Middle East, specifically to Baghdad. Over time, Arab mathematicians refined and disseminated the system throughout the Islamic world. By the 11th century, European scholars began adopting Arabic numerals, marking a turning point in the history of mathematics.

    Arabic numerals are comprised of ten distinct symbols, with a decimal point allowing for fractions. Roman numerals, on the other hand, use a combination of letters (I, V, X, L, C, D, and M) to represent numbers. Roman numerals can be more complex and cumbersome for calculations, where Arabic numerals offer a more streamlined approach.

  • Arabic numerals, also known as Hindu-Arabic numerals, consist of ten digits: 0, 1, 2, 3, 4, 5, 6, 7, 8, and 9. These symbols allow for efficient and accurate mathematical calculations. The numeral system is based on the concept of the decimal point, enabling easy conversion between fractions and whole numbers. By using a set of base ten symbols, operations like addition and multiplication become simplified, paving the way for complex mathematical operations.

  • Arabic numerals operate on a decimal system, using place values to represent numbers. Each digit's value is determined by its position within the number. For instance, the number 456 can be broken down into (400 + 50 + 6), demonstrating how each digit contributes to the final result. This principle enables arithmetic calculations and allows for fractions to be expressed in decimal form.
